Price of Assembly

Assembly offers four pricing plans tailored for employee recognition needs. The Recognition plan starts at $2.00 per member/month billed annually, focusing on core recognition features and essential integrations with Slack and MS Teams. The Engagement plan at $4.00 per member/month builds on this foundation, adding automated notifications, surveys, games, and contests to boost engagement. The Culture Suite plan, priced at $6.00 per member/month, offers advanced automation, AI assistance, and comprehensive training. A Custom plan is also available, designed for large organizations; pricing for this option is provided upon request today.

Price of Motivosity

Motivosity pricing is structured into three main plans, each designed for distinct employee recognition needs. The Standard Plan requires a $3,000 minimum annual spend and delivers automated awards, peer appreciation, global rewards, and multi-platform access with analytics and integrations. The Pro Plan, available at a custom rate, builds on these features with enhanced recognition management, challenges, incentives, and personalized support. For unique requirements, the Custom Plan offers a tailored solution via a custom quote. Note that no free trial is offered, so contacting Motivosity is necessary for detailed pricing discussions.

What is Knowlarity Cloud Contact Center?

Knowlarity Cloud Contact Center is a cloud-based SaaS platform designed to transform traditional contact center operations into a flexible, scalable environment. It supports multiple communication channels including voice, video, and AI-driven interactions, making it ideal for businesses seeking to deliver personalized and real-time customer experiences efficiently.

Key capabilities include intelligent call routing, detailed call recording, and comprehensive call tracking. After each call, the system generates extensive records capturing metrics such as call duration, type, and agent performance. These insights are accessible through a user-friendly interface that provides real-time monitoring and detailed reporting, empowering organizations to evaluate agent productivity and overall contact center effectiveness.

The platform’s cloud infrastructure ensures high availability and robust data security by encrypting communications and centralizing sensitive information. This architecture supports remote work by allowing agents and supervisors to operate seamlessly from any location, maintaining uninterrupted business operations beyond conventional office settings.

Integration is a standout feature, enabling smooth connectivity with CRM systems and other business tools through APIs. This creates unified workflows and consolidated data management. Additional functionalities include interactive voice response (IVR) systems, virtual phone numbers, SMS integration, click-to-call, voicemail, live call monitoring, and multi-tier IVR configurations to address diverse customer service requirements.

By leveraging automated analytics and continuous performance tracking, Knowlarity helps businesses optimize communication workflows, enhance customer satisfaction, and boost efficiency. What to look for in Knowlarity Cloud Contact Center alternatives?

When considering alternatives to Knowlarity Cloud Contact Center, it is vital to thoroughly evaluate the core functionalities that your organization depends on. Knowlarity offers features such as virtual numbers, IVR systems, toll-free numbers, click-to-call, call recording, analytics, call tracking, lead management, multi-level IVR, and voicemail. These capabilities are essential for companies aiming to enhance customer communication and streamline call center processes.

Matching critical features is a must. Pay close attention to internal call transfer, call forwarding, multiuser login with role-based permissions, mobile app availability, call conferencing, and outbound calling. Without ensuring these are present in any replacement, operational disruptions are likely.

Scalability is equally important. Knowlarity serves a range of businesses, especially small and medium enterprises, so any alternative must accommodate growth with flexible pricing and support for multiple extensions and access points.

Integration with current CRM systems, workforce management tools, and analytics platforms is non-negotiable. The solution should offer intuitive dashboards to minimize training time and maximize agent efficiency, thereby improving overall user experience.

Reliability is paramount: assess the provider’s customer support quality, uptime guarantees, and responsiveness. Look for strong service-level agreements and comprehensive onboarding to ensure smooth adoption.

Security and compliance cannot be overlooked. Confirm the platform aligns with industry regulations, particularly regarding data privacy and call recording standards.

Finally, reviewing customer feedback and satisfaction ratings provides valuable insight into real-world performance and potential challenges that may not be evident during demos.
